Chapter Frl 800 - CREMATORIES
Part Frl 801 - CREMATORY REGULATIONS
Section Frl 801.02 - Definitions

(a) "Authorizing agent" means "authorizing agent" as defined in RSA 325-A:1, II.

(b) "Board" means "board" as defined in RSA 325-A:1, III.

(c) "Change of ownership" means the change in the controlling interest of an established crematory.

(d) "Communicable disease" means "communicable disease" as defined in RSA 141-C:2, VI.

(e) "Cremated remains" means "cremated remains" as defined in RSA 325-A:1, V.

(f) "Cremation" means the technical process that uses heat and evaporation to reduce human remains to bone fragments, and which involves the processing of such remains by pulverization, leaving only bone fragments reduced to unidentifiable dimensions, and the unrecoverable residue of any foreign matter, such as eyeglasses, bridgework, or other similar material, that was cremated with the human remains.

(g) "Cremation chamber" means the enclosed space within which a cremation takes place.

(h) "Crematory" means a building or portion of a building which contains a cremation chamber and holding facility.

(i) "Crematory operator" means "crematory operator" as defined in RSA 325-A:1, XI.

(j) "Designated agent" means the individual authorized to have custody and control of the human remains pursuant to RSA 290:17.

(k) "Funeral director" means "funeral director" as defined in RSA 325:1, VIII.

(l) "Holding facility" means the area of a crematory designated for the retention of human remains prior to cremation and includes a refrigerated facility.

(m) "Human remains" means the body of a deceased person, or human body part, in any stage of decomposition and includes limbs or other portions of the anatomy that are removed from a person or human remains for medical purposes during treatment, surgery, biopsy, autopsy, or medical research.

(n) "Leak proof pouch" means a plastic, vinyl, or similar material bag that is made specifically for the containment of human remains.

(o) "Next-of-kin" means "next-of-kin" as defined in RSA 290:16, IV.

(p) "Owner" means the individual, partnership or corporation with a controlling interest in the crematory.

(q) "Suitable solid container" means a rigid container, that is designed for the encasement and disposition of human remains before cremation.

(r) "Urn" means a decorative container used for placement of cremated remains that varies in size, styling, and composition.

(s) "Violations against a decedent" means actions that desecrate or tamper with the human remains or personal effects, lead to the misidentification of a decedent, or allow the commingling of cremated remains of more than one decedent.
